Former New York Yankees and Seattle Mariners catcher Jesús Montero has died. He was 35 years old. The Venezuelan native passed away from injuries sustained in a motorcycle accident in his home country.
The New York Yankees organization confirmed the tragic news. They expressed deep sadness over the passing of their former top prospect.
Career of a Once-Touted Prospect
Montero signed with the Yankees as an international free agent in 2006. He was just 16 years old at the time. His $1.6 million signing bonus signaled high expectations.
He quickly became one of baseball’s most promising hitters. Montero rocketed through the minor leagues with impressive stats. According to Reuters, he ranked as high as number three on Baseball America’s Top 100 prospects list.
His MLB debut in September 2011 was explosive. Montero hit .328 with four home runs in just 18 games. This performance created significant buzz for his future.
A Career Diverted and a Tragic End
Montero’s path changed in December 2011. The Yankees traded him to the Seattle Mariners for pitcher Michael Pineda. His career never regained its initial momentum in Seattle.
He last played in Major League Baseball in 2015. Montero later played in the Mexican League and Venezuelan Winter League. His final professional appearances came in 2021.
The accident occurred in early October in Valencia, Venezuela. Reports from Venezuelan media indicate his motorcycle was struck by a pickup truck. He was hospitalized and placed in an induced coma before succumbing to his injuries weeks later.

Did Jesús Montero face any suspensions during his career?
Yes, he received a 50-game suspension in 2013. This was connected to the Biogenesis performance-enhancing drug scandal. The suspension occurred during his time with the Seattle Mariners.
